[Bug 82203] Re: feisty network-manager unable to connect to WEP wireless

2007-02-12 Thread Lukin
I experienced the same problem on Feisty Herd3 (actually Feb 11 daily). I used this report as a guide to fix it. Here's what I did: 1) Tried to connect to my WEP enabled router, it failed 2) Created a new key ring (one existed called "session", I named this new one "test") 3) Tried connecting, st

[Bug 82203] Re: feisty network-manager unable to connect to WEP wireless

2007-01-29 Thread hggdh
Interesting. I noticed that, at no time, I was asked for my keyring password. (knetworkmanager remembered about it :-) And... indeed, I had *NO* keyring (so, no password), under Gnome. So I went into Control Center, and created a brand new keyring. I then re-installed network-manager-gnome, clos
